GKI: This year's business expectations are in nadir in July
Compared to the April peak, the business and consumer confidence expectations have deteriorated in July.
However, the reduction of the GKI-Erste sentiment index was due to the significant drop in the business confidence index.
Within the business sphere, the expectations of all sectors – excluding construction industry – have declined in July, compared to the previous month. The business confidence index fell from 5.4 points to 1.4 points, so overall, more companies expect improvement than a deterioration. GKI’s survey was carried out with the support of the European Union. (MTI)
